Aging Matters in Brevard (EIN 59-1110325) reports 403(B) THRIFT PLAN OF AGING MATTERS IN BREVARD on its most recent Form 5500, with $1.5M in plan assets across 108 active participants. Form 5500 is the annual report employers file with the U.S. Department of Labor for their retirement plans, and it’s public.

Aging Matters in Brevard’s Form 5500 doesn’t separately disclose a recordkeeper we can confirm. The firms named on its Schedule C are service providers — which can include investment managers, trustees, and auditors, and are not necessarily the company that runs your account. To find who runs your 401(k), check your enrollment paperwork or a recent statement, or ask Aging Matters in BrevardHR for the recordkeeper’s name and login.
